I have an older generation razberry that i still use and bought in 2013.
My question is if the firmware can be upgraded for it to support z-wave plus or if it would require a current gen razberry?
As I don’t use the z-way software I’d have to go through some hassle if I need to upgrade the firmware, so rather would like to know beforehand if a firmware upgrade would be worth the effort, or if I need to go straight for the hardware upgrade.

This old RaZberry is using older chips that do not have newer versions since 2014-2015. Newer are working only on new chips.
But Z-Wave Plus can also be supported on those old firmwares too, so no need to upgrade if you don't care about 100kbit speed
